Springtime Electrical Checkup!

Spring is the perfect time to do many things, like get your oil changed in your car, clean up your yard etc. It is also a perfect time to give your home an electrical safety checkup!


  1. Are your outlets and switches working correctly? If they are not working properly this could be a hazard in your home because the wiring could be unsafe which could lead to a fire. 
  2. Are your outlets or switches feeling warm? If you go to touch an outlet or switch and they feel hot, this could indicate there is a problem with the wiring in your home. You should stop using the outlet right away and have an electrician (or us Quality Electric Service :) ) come out to troubleshoot it. 
  3. Are your outlets or switches discolored? Discoloration of outlets and switches can mean that there is heat building up with the connections. Don't just ignore them, if that happens then it could cause melting or ever a fire. 
  4. Are you hearing sizzling, buzzing, or crackling noises? Those noises usually signal unsafe wiring or a loose connection somewhere.

Are you ready for the 2017 Hurricane Season?

Hurricane season is rapidly approaching us with only a little over a month away. This year NOAA has predicted 12 total named storms, 6 will turn into hurricanes and 2 will be a category 3 or higher hurricane.

We all know that hurricanes  can produce extremely high, dangerous winds, along with lightning and hail.  Power outages are all too common once a hurricane has stricken, and they are to be expected.  The high winds can take down power poles and cause damage to power plants.  It can take weeks and in many cases, months before power company personnel are able to fully restore power.

Being without power for hours even days at a time become such an inconvenience and an expensive one too. Your food can spoil, mold grows and basements that are prone to flooding are robbed of their working sump pump and being to take on water. These types of situations is where an Automatic Home Standby Generac Generator comes in handy. Once your electric goes out your generator turns on automatically, all hands free. The unit is wired into the homes electrical panel, eliminating extension cords. It begins powering heat, air condition, and well pumps moments after utility power fails. This means when it senses utility power has returned it safely shuts itself down and returns to standby mode.
